Electrodeposition of thin film semiconductors
Description
A survey of thin film electrodeposited elemental alloy and compound semiconductors is given. The theoretical aspects of the electrodeposition of elemental and binary semiconductors are discussed by considering the Nernst equation and Pourbaix (potential-pH) diagrams. The elemental, binary, and ternary semiconductors together with their electrodeposition and physical and chemical properties are described. The applications of electrodeposited semiconductors in solid state solar cells and photoelectrochemical cells are presented and their solar conversion efficiencies are reported. It can be concluded that the preparation of thin film semiconductors with the electrodeposition technique possesses many advantages. The properties of electrodeposited semiconductors are comparable with those of semiconductors prepared by other methods 95 refs
